SOUTHERN SECTION DIVISION I BADMINTON : Overmatched Garden Grove Routed by Keppel in Final

On one hand, Garden Grove’s badminton team played as well as any team has against Alhambra Keppel, which has not given up more than five points all season.

On the other hand, the Argonauts were handily defeated by Keppel, 15-4, in the Southern Section Division I team badminton final Wednesday at Cypress College.

“We were overmatched today,” Argonaut Coach Vicki Toutz said. “Keppel is a very dominant team. We played very respectable today. We’re a very young team and I never expected us to get this far.”

The Aztecs, the Southern Section defending champions, won the first eight matches.

“Their team is very strong,” Aztec Coach Harold George said. “It just happens that our strength is where their strengths are.”

Junior Mike Lam scored the first point for the Argonauts with a 15-8, 10-15, 15-7 singles victory over Ken Lam.

By that point, the Argonauts knew they were playing for respect.

Nowhere was this more evident than in Vil Nonliboun’s singles match against Lam. After losing his matches in mixed doubles and first singles, the senior fought back from a 9-4 deficit in the third game to defeat Lam, 5-15, 15-7, 15-12.

“Vil has not performed as well as he wanted to in his last couple of matches,” Toutz said. “I’m glad that he was able to come back and finish (the season) with a strong performance.”

Trailing in the third game, Nonliboun used drop shots and smashes to win the next four points and close the gap to 9-8. After exchanging points, Nonliboun tied the score, 11-11, with a net-hugging redrop.

Nonliboun took a 14-12 lead with a smash down the line and won the set with a strong smash down the middle.

“I always put 100% and try to do the best that I can,” Nonliboun said. “Sometimes I’m successful, sometimes I’m overmatched. Against (Lam) I was successful.”

The Argonauts’ two other points came from its doubles teams. Dung Cu and David Nguyen defeated Jacky Wu and Tony Tan, 15-2, 4-15, 15-10. Rashi Gupta and Hanh Le defeated Cindy Wong and Aileen Dong, 15-10, 15-9.
